الملخص EN

Graphene nanoplatelets (GNP) filled epoxy composites ranged from 0.2 to 5 vol.% were prepared in this study using simple heat assisted bath sonication for better GNP dispersion and exfoliation.

The effects of GNP filler loading via heat assisted bath sonication on the mechanical properties and thermal deformation behaviour were investigated.

Improvements on flexural strength and fracture toughness up to 0.4 vol.% filler loading were recorded.

Further addition of GNP filler loading shows a deteriorating behaviour on the mechanical properties on the composites.

The bulk electrical conductivity of the epoxy composites is greatly improved with the addition of GNP filler loading up to 1 vol.%.

The thermal expansion of epoxy composites is reduced with the addition of GNP; however poor thermal stability of the composites is observed.
